Output adb95323c1aa4b43bb59dd3b877734b04375252dcb29f0610d94f033551641be:0

value
20331000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ae1a68f78132f6276076fa7dc414919a42d7a8f8 OP_EQUALVERIFY OP_CHECKSIG
address
Lb6XUbJqVAdkp1fRKp2Ej47ussCDBT3NL7
transaction
adb95323c1aa4b43bb59dd3b877734b04375252dcb29f0610d94f033551641be
spent
true